Abstract
In one embodiment, the system includes a processor, referred to herein as a tandem access controller (TAC), coupled to the PSTN, where the TAC allows a subscriber to set-up and make changes to the configuration of his or her phone line or other communications device. Such changes include selective call forwarding. In one embodiment, the TAC is controlled by the subscriber using the web. The TAC is coupled internally to the PSTN in a local service area and is outside the central office of the subscriber. A calling party makes a first call to the subscriber using the subscriber'"'"'s public telephone number. The TAC receives the first call prior to the call reaching the subscriber'"'"'s terminating central office, which in some cases avoids a toll. The TAC then carries out the subscriber'"'"'s instructions for the first call, such as making one or more second calls using telephone numbers different from the subscriber'"'"'s public telephone number. When the second call is answered, the answering phone is connected by the TAC to the caller.

11. A telephone system comprising:
-
a public switched telephone network (PSTN) having a tandem switch; and a tandem access controller (TAC), within the PSTN, coupled to said tandem switch, said TAC being accessible via the Internet by at least one subscriber for selecting features to be applied to telephone calls intended for said subscriber routed through said PSTN, said TAC being in a local service area with respect to said subscriber, said TAC being configured to receive a first call by a calling party, entering a first telephone number, intended for said subscriber, said TAC receiving the first call prior to the first call reaching a terminating central office, said TAC being configured to apply said features to said first call, for placing a second call to said subscriber using a second telephone number different from said first telephone number, and to complete a communications path between said calling party and said subscriber after said subscriber has answered said second call. - View Dependent Claims (12, 13, 14, 15, 16, 17)
